Will the school be registered, and which curriculum will it integrate into for further education?+

In Portugal, schools do not become recognized through moodboards alone. They need formal authorization, defined educational levels, identified buildings, and actual compliance. Until that exists, the school remains best understood as a concept note with excellent lighting.

How will it work to own my house? Are plots individual?+

Public language around ‘deeded plots’ sounds reassuring, but the legal structure matters a lot. If a project operates under a tourism-enterprise framework, ownership can come bundled with operator control, tourism-exploitation obligations, and usage conditions. Translation: ask for the exact legal regime before naming your olive tree.

Can I live there permanently?+

Spiritually, perhaps. Legally, that depends on the licensing and planning framework. If a development is structured primarily for tourism use, your experience may be closer to ‘beautifully managed belonging’ than classic unrestricted permanent housing.
